The quality factor (Q) is as follows under the conditions of both Short Delay & Long Delay.
1 C1
Q=
3 C2
At all the cut off frequency is decided by the external C.
We recommend C1=0.0047µF and C2=0.001µF.
Under this condition, fc and Q are as follows.
Surround fc=7.3kHz Q=0.72
Echo
fc=3.1kHz
* The Cut Off Frequency of LPF means the cut off frequency of the each stage (A/D & D/A)
and doesn't mean the total cut off frequency.
